Sandra Brown says women are often ‘success-struck’ by the psychopaths true or surface success. This blinds them to his psychopathy. When trusting women expect psychopaths to be criminals, they don’t expect them in an office.
Psychopaths seek out positions with power over others:
medical doctors
psychiatrists or other positions within other fields of psychology.
They can be slick but not always violent, have exploitive ethics and have impressive management while conscienceless.
